本文目錄導(dǎo)讀:
如何在CSS中控制em標(biāo)簽的樣式而不使其顯示為斜體
在網(wǎng)頁設(shè)計(jì)中,CSS(層疊樣式表)是一種用于描述HTML元素如何在瀏覽器中呈現(xiàn)的語言,em標(biāo)簽在HTML中通常用于強(qiáng)調(diào)文本,其默認(rèn)樣式是斜體,有時(shí)候我們可能希望改變這種默認(rèn)行為,比如在特定的設(shè)計(jì)或布局中,我們不希望em標(biāo)簽顯示為斜體,如何在CSS中做到這一點(diǎn)呢?
理解em標(biāo)簽的默認(rèn)行為
我們需要知道em標(biāo)簽在HTML中的默認(rèn)樣式是斜體,這是由瀏覽器的默認(rèn)樣式表決定的,在沒有特別指定的情況下,瀏覽器會(huì)按照其默認(rèn)樣式表來渲染HTML元素。
使用CSS覆蓋默認(rèn)樣式
我們可以通過編寫CSS規(guī)則來覆蓋em標(biāo)簽的默認(rèn)樣式,我們可以為em標(biāo)簽設(shè)置一個(gè)font-style屬性值為normal的CSS規(guī)則,以取消斜體效果。
em { font-style: normal; }
應(yīng)用樣式到特定元素
如果你想讓這種樣式改變只應(yīng)用到某個(gè)特定的em元素,你可以使用類名或ID來更***地選擇元素,假設(shè)你有一個(gè)類名為“.my-em”的em元素,你可以這樣寫:
.my-em { font-style: normal; }
或者,如果你知道某個(gè)em元素的ID,你也可以這樣寫:
#my-id em { font-style: normal; }
驗(yàn)證和測試
別忘了在你的網(wǎng)頁上驗(yàn)證和測試你的CSS規(guī)則是否有效,確保你的CSS規(guī)則被正確地加載和應(yīng)用,然后檢查em標(biāo)簽是否不再顯示為斜體。
通過CSS,我們可以輕松地改變em標(biāo)簽的樣式,使其不再顯示為斜體,這對(duì)于實(shí)現(xiàn)各種網(wǎng)頁設(shè)計(jì)和布局非常有用。